Catherine Seton 1410–1478 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 1410

Birth Location: Seton, East Lothian, Scotland

Death Date: 7 FEB 1478

Death Location: Caerlaverock Castle, Dumfries-shire, Scotland

Father: William Seton

Mother: Janet Dunbar

Spouse(s): Herbert Maxwell, Alan Stewart

Children(s): John Stewart, Elizabeth Stewart, Alexander Stewart

The story of Catherine Seton began in 1410 in Seton, East Lothian, Scotland. Catherine Seton married Alan Stewart, Herbert Maxwell, and had children including Alexander Darnley Stewart, Elizabeth Stewart, John Stewart. Catherine Seton passed away in 1478 in Caerlaverock Castle, Dumfries-shire, Scotland.
